I have tried using the webcam-osx/macam application with a "TerraCam  
USB Pro" that is listed as "should work" in the "Supported Cameras"  
list. It does not work.

It is connected directly to a USB 2.0 port of a PowerMac G5.

System Profiler provides the following info:

USB Camera:

   Version:     1.00
   Bus Power (mA):      500
   Speed:       Up to 12 Mb/sec
   Manufacturer:        OmniVision Technologies, Inc.
   Product ID:  0xa518
   Vendor ID:   0x05a9

A search through the macam sources revealed this:

#define VENDOR_OVT              0x05A9
--and--
#define PRODUCT_OV518                   0x0518
Is it possible that the camera has an OV518 instead of the OV511+?  
There is no driver support ("unsupported (no camera)") for the OV518  
even though it's mentioned in the sources several times.
